Почему я получаю синтаксическую ошибку внутри цикла while?

Я получаю синтаксическую ошибку в строке 11, которую я не понимаю.

T = int(raw_input())
L = []
for i in range(0,T):
    num = int(raw_input())
    L.append(num)
for b in L:
    n = 0
    sum = 0
    while b - (4 * n) > 0:
       term = (2 * (int(b/2)) - ((4 * n) + 3 )
       sum = sum + term
       n = n + 1
    print sum

1 ответ

Решение

У вас нет закрывающей скобки в:

term = (2 * (int(b/2)) - ((4 * n) + 3 )
Другие вопросы по тегам